Thanks, but...

Won't quite fix my problem. Most of the late model 600's have the hydro suspension, at least on the rear, and some even have full hydro. Your guy may have been able to adjust the ride height by tricking the computer a bit, which won't work on a us spec 500. Nice looking SL, thanks.

If were talking about an SL500 w/o ADS then I would suggest a set of eBay H&R Springs lowering springs. I put a set of H&R springs, new Bilstein struts/shocks, strut mounts, and #1 shim on the front and #3 shim on the rear. H&R p/n 29853 is the same for ALL R129 chassis (1990-2002) except hydraulic with ADS.
